Just gotta ask since I'm about to replace the rear leafs on my truck. By the looks of it, the back is lowered, is it with springs? If so, do you have those setback plates or not? The rear tires look a bit foward (or it could be just me).
 

T-Bone

Active member
Re: Post a pic of your truck taken today

Just gotta ask since I'm about to replace the rear leafs on my truck. By the looks of it, the back is lowered, is it with springs? If so, do you have those setback plates or not? The rear tires look a bit foward (or it could be just me).

2" lowering blocks. The 250 pounds in the bed made it squat a bit more than the normal stance. The axle is forward about 1" due to the LSx engine install. I intend to put an custom length aluminum DS in it that compensates for the distance so the rear axle can be centered. You have a superb set of eyes!!
